SYNTHETIC METHOD BY CROSS-COUPLING BETWEEN ALKYNE AND ALKENE

摘要

PROBLEM TO BE SOLVED: To provide a new synthetic method by cross-coupling between an alkyne and an alkene using a palladium catalyst.;SOLUTION: A synthetic method of a β-(alkenyl)ethylchlorosilane that comprises causing an acetylene derivative having one triple bond to react with an ethylene derivative having one double bond in the presence of [(η3-C3H5)PdA]+[PF6]- (wherein A is 1,5-cyclooctadiene, an aromatic isocyanide or an N-heterocyclic carbene) and adding chlorohydrosilane is provided. A synthetic method of a β-(alkenyl)ethylalkoxysilane comprising causing the obtained β-(alkenyl)ethylchlorosilane to react with an alcohol is also provided.;COPYRIGHT: (C)2007,JPO&INPIT
